Roofing repairs vary depending on the extent of the damage and the materials involved. If your leak is isolated to a few shingles, the fix is usually straightforward. However, if the underlying decking is rotted or the flashing around your chimney is compromised, the labor and material needs increase. Steep roof pitches can also add to the cost due to safety requirements. We assess your unique situation to give you a clear picture of what is needed.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

The summer heat is perfect for roof work because materials are flexible and sealants set properly. This is the best season to replace damaged flashing or address ventilation issues that might be driving up your cooling bills. EPDM roofing is a synthetic rubber membrane commonly used for flat or low-slope roofs. It's known for its durability and resistance to UV radiation, making it a suitable option for Memphis's climate. The main types of roof shingles include asphalt, architectural, wood shake, and metal. Asphalt shingles are common and affordable, while architectural shingles offer more dimension.
